Vuetify数据表不显示数据,显示1行中有1行显示,但表体为空。我的组件代码:<template> <v-data-table :headers="headers" :items="desserts" > </v-data-table></template><script>export default { name: 'Users', data () { return { headers: [ { text: 'Dessert (100g serving)', align: 'left', sortable: false, value: 'name' }, { text: 'Fat (g)', value: 'fat' }, ], desserts: [ { name: 'Frozen Yogurt', fat: 6.0, }, ] } }}</script><style scoped ></style>结果:知道如何解决这个问题吗?
2 回答
![?](http://img1.sycdn.imooc.com/533e4d00000171e602000200-100-100.jpg)
海绵宝宝撒
TA贡献1809条经验 获得超8个赞
就我而言,问题是我将headers
数组放在了props
部分而不是data
. 因此,即使v-datatable
将其items
属性设置为一组对象(可以使用 Vue Dev Tools 确认;Chrome 扩展程序),它也不会显示任何行。
敲了半个小时头,才终于意识到这个问题。一旦我headers
从props
移到data
,表格就开始显示行。希望这可以帮助某人在路上。
添加回答
举报
0/150
提交
取消